WebGreen/Mild/Slightly Bitter - Bok choy is mild, versatile, and fairly neutral, with a relatively sweet, very slightly bitter and/or mustard-like flavour. The flavour is relatively similar raw and cooked, though the texture differs markedly. Raw stalks are crisp (somewhat like celery) while the leaves have a texture like spinach. Explanation: Petsay is a popular vegetable in the ... i just want to be the one you love 1 hourWeb19 sep. 2009 · Chinese cabbages falling under the Chinensis group do not form heads. Commercially, they are sold under various names including bok choy, pak choy, pei tsai and choy sum. Some hybrids have white stalks (like the Filipino pechay ); others have light green stalks (like Taiwanese bok choy ).
